NOTE:

The default path for the Help files is C:/Program Files/Avaya_ Wireless/AP/HTML/index.htm. (Use the forward slash character ("/") rather than the backslash character ("\") when configuring the Help Link location.) The AP Help information is available in English, French, German, Italian, Spanish, and Japanese.
